However the embedded version in the PDF may look like the original, and may have the same name, but it can be encoded differently - this is why you see garbage.Įncoding fonts, especially Unicode, can use several methods - including non-standard lookup tables - and some printer drivers aren't able to read the more obscure encoding sequences, so will throw a bad font substitution. If a font with the same name is installed, the printer driver will either use the embedded one, or the installed one, depending on the settings in your printer software. If the driver likes what it's sent, it'll print using it - if not it'll substitute the "damaged" font for something else, usually Courier or Times. If the PDF contains an embedded non-base font which isn't installed in the operating system, Acrobat will attach that font data into the Postscript stream sent to your printer driver. This is usually a conflict over Postscript fonts - not easy to fix and not always for a logical reason, but the issue is in where the font is coming from.
